The Eerie Inn is a mystery, puzzle-solving horror game with a strong emphasis on the narrative. You play as one of the girls staying at a guest house and your mission is to find out the truth behind the mysterious things happening there. You will soon realize that things aren't what they appear to be..

Reviews: Positive — 81% — of 43 reviews
Released: 2018-04-19
Developer: Przestraszeni
Genres: Adventure, Indie
Platforms: Windows
